Transaction 571ade6e55c06e4531653b06397b667f9af4f91ccb1f12449f79f8c19235b12a
1 Input
1 Output
-
571ade6e55c06e4531653b06397b667f9af4f91ccb1f12449f79f8c19235b12a:0
- value
- 2223973
- script pubkey
- OP_0 OP_PUSHBYTES_20 8e3a6197bee4331a4c21734bc94ebffd4229cbac
- address
- bc1q3caxr9a7use35nppwd9ujn4ll4pznjavfkeyfu